Villa Centanini in Stanghella is a 19th-century neoclassical residence offering an authentic experience away from the crowds. The villa features a symmetrical façade with a central portico, side barchesse, and a historic park with centuries-old trees. Ideal for a half-day trip, it can be combined with exploring the villages of the Po Delta or a stop at typical trattorias.

Historical Overview
- Latter half of the 19th century: Construction of the villa in neoclassical style as a stately home.
- 20th century: Use as a residence and agricultural estate center.
- Contemporary era: Restoration and promotion as a historical and cultural asset.

💡 Did You Know…?
A curiosity that makes the visit special is tied to its location. Villa Centanini stands in an area historically linked to the land reclamation of Lower Padua. Looking at the surrounding landscape, you can imagine how, centuries ago, these lands were marshy and how human labor transformed them into fertile fields. The villa itself, with its solid and orderly structure, seems to symbolize the triumph of rationality and order over wild nature. This connection to the history of the territory, made of toil and transformation, adds an extra layer of meaning to its elegant beauty.
